Caring for your Wandering Jew Plant is simple. Place it in a location with bright, indirect sunlight. Water when the top inch of soil feels dry to the touch, and avoid overwatering. The plant prefers well-draining soil and moderate humidity. With proper care, your Wandering Jew will thrive and continue to add beauty to your home for years to come. Regular pruning can help maintain its shape and encourage bushier growth.

Frequently Asked Questions
- How much sunlight does a Wandering Jew Plant need? Wandering Jew plants thrive in bright, indirect sunlight. Avoid direct sunlight, which can scorch their leaves.
- How often should I water my Pink Wandering Jew Plant? Water when the top inch of soil feels dry. Overwatering can lead to root rot, so ensure the pot has good drainage.
- What is the ideal temperature for a Wandering Jew Live Plant? These plants prefer temperatures between 60°F and 80°F (15°C and 27°C).
- How do I propagate a Wandering Jew Plant? Wandering Jew plants are easily propagated from stem cuttings. Simply place a cutting in water or directly into moist soil.
- Why are the leaves on my Wandering Jew Plant turning brown? Brown leaves can be a sign of underwatering, overwatering, or exposure to direct sunlight. Adjust watering habits and ensure the plant is in a suitable location.
